Equinix
Equinix is a leader in the AI & Data Center segment of the semiconductor & AI supply chain, headquartered in United States. Its key suppliers include Crusoe Energy, Vertiv, Schneider Electric. Its key customers include CoreWeave, Nebius Group, Oracle.
World's largest data-center and interconnection REIT.

About Equinix
Equinix, headquartered in United States, operates in the Data Center REITs segment of the semiconductor & AI supply chain and is positioned as a market leader there. Its key products include IBX data-center colocation, Equinix Fabric interconnection platform, Equinix Metal bare-metal cloud, Equinix AI data centers, Network Edge virtual network services. wafergraph maps 11 tracked suppliers and 7 tracked customers for Equinix across the value chain.
